    Yes, but being quite honest, their dateability in my eyes would largely be a function of how human, for lack of a better term, they were. Your typical elf is basically a thousand-year old supermodel with pointed ears. I could date that. A Klingon woman? I had a thing for Lursa and B'etor growing up, I think in retrospect based largely on the Powergirl principle, but we would first need to set some ground rules about violence in the bedroom that a Klingon, at least as they were often portrayed, might not want to agree with.

    A Hydran from Star Fleet Battles? For those of you unfamiliar with the game, the Hydrans have bodies that are about 1.3 meters tall, fairly cylindrical in shape, walk about on three stumpy legs, use tentacles instead of arms, breathe methane, and have three genders: male, female and a barely-sentient third gender that takes the sperm and egg from the ovipositors of the male and female and incubates the young. More sensible in their morphology than an Ocampa, certainly, but dateable? That would be a profound stretch of the imagination when you realize that even if I got the right gender, I couldn't kiss her without suffocating her simultaneously.
